NBA 2K26 Update 1.015 Improves Stability and Online Performance
🛠️ System Stability Enhancements
NBA 2K26 Update 1.015 is a maintenance-focused patch designed to improve overall game stability. Rather than adjusting gameplay balance or adding new content, this update targets backend performance to help reduce crashes, freezes, and unexpected errors.
Players on PlayStation 5 and Xbox Series X | S should notice a smoother overall experience, especially during longer play sessions and high-traffic online periods. |
🌐 Improved Online Reliability
One of the main goals of Update 1.015 is to improve online session stability. Recent player feedback pointed to increased disconnects and error codes, particularly in competitive online modes.
This patch focuses on making online matches more reliable, helping reduce interruptions in modes such as:
The Rec
Pro-Am
The Park
Other online multiplayer environments
With better session handling, players should see fewer dropped games and smoother matchmaking experiences.
